Tuntari enters safe zone

Published on Thursday, 17 Mar 2016 12:56 PM


Even though Nara Rohit’s Tuntari opened to mixed reviews last week, the film has now entered the safe zone. Trade pundits reveal that lack of big releases and huge support from TDP and Balakrishna fans ensured the film decent openings.

Latest reports suggest that the film has broke even now and all the distributors with be in the safe zone this week. Directed by Kumar Nagendra, Tuntari was appreciated for Nara Rohit’s hilarious antics and comedy.

Sai Kartheek composed music and Latha Hegde played the female lead.
